PDB protein is a term that relates to the Protein Data Bank, which is an essential resource for researchers and scientists in the field of biochemistry and molecular biology. This database contains detailed information about the three-dimensional structures of proteins, nucleic acids, and complex assemblies. By accessing PDB protein data, researchers can gain insights into the molecular mechanisms of various biological processes, aiding in drug design, understanding disease mechanisms, and advancing biotechnology.
Understanding PDB protein structures is crucial for anyone involved in scientific research or interested in the molecular underpinnings of life. The data available can help identify how proteins interact with each other and with other molecules, which is vital for developing new therapies and treatments.
